When I was a wee girl - many moons ago - if I had a sore neck, or swollen glands, Mum would wrap one of her stockings (silk back then, not nylon) soaked in vinegar! That worked!! Her older sister used to put a stocking soaked in vinegar around her forehead when she had a headache - never cured her headache just gave her sore eyes!!

Bruce - your comment reminded me of when we were in France only a few years ago, small village in the south, and I had a terrible cough. Went to the local "pharmacie" and he made me up a mixture of his own, After a couple of tablespoons I started to feel better and after a day of taking it, even better. it was when i looked at the label closely I worked out why - it was 14% alcohol. Wish they made cough medicine like that here.

Yes Jan your OH is right, I too remember Cod Liver Oil and malt. Dragon (my Mother) used to line us all up and with a dessert spoon we'd al be fed it. George (my Dad - hence Dragon's nickname), my two Sisters and I and at the end of the line was our cat who also got to lick the spoon.

If we had muscle pains or strains we were given a poultice of 'Sloan's Linament' - it smelled disgusting and it burned.
